Poster of Cast and Crew in Win Ben Stein's Money - Season 1 - Episode 65 - Season 1, Episode 65

Win Ben Stein's Money - Season 1 - Season 1, Episode 65 (Episode 65)

Episode Aired On:
No estimated release date